For 25 years, Eclipse Compliance Testing has stood shoulder to shoulder with regulators and operators to uphold the integrity of gaming across tribal communities and beyond. Founded in 2000 by Nick and Janice Farley, Eclipse has grown into a trusted partner for independent testing, serving over 250 regulated jurisdictions and specializing in Class II, Class III, Lottery, iGaming, Charitable Gaming and Sports Betting Systems.

Built on Trust, Grown Through Partnership

With ISO 17025/17020 accreditations, Eclipse operates in Solon, Ohio and Las Vegas, Nevada—two flagship laboratories that have helped shape the company’s agile and reliable reputation.
